Italy Proposes 50% Increase to Wealthy Expat Flat Tax Amid Housing Concerns

The Italian government is reportedly planning a significant 50% increase to its flat tax scheme for wealthy foreign residents. According to sources, the measure would raise the annual payment to €300,000 while simultaneously providing tax relief for lower and middle-income workers.

Major Tax Shift for Wealthy Foreign Residents

Italy’s government is reportedly planning to increase the flat tax on foreign income for wealthy individuals relocating to the country by 50%, according to recent reports. Sources indicate the measure would raise the annual payment from €200,000 to €300,000 for those taking advantage of the special tax regime.

Meta Introduces Enhanced AI Safety Features for Teen Users Following Regulatory Scrutiny

Meta is developing new parental controls that will enable parents to restrict their children’s interactions with AI characters across its platforms. The announcement comes amid ongoing regulatory scrutiny regarding child safety in digital environments. These features are expected to roll out early next year as the company addresses concerns about mental health impacts on younger users.

New AI Safety Measures for Younger Users

Meta Platforms is developing enhanced parental controls that will allow parents to restrict their children’s interactions with artificial intelligence characters, according to the company’s recent announcement. Sources indicate these controls will enable parents to completely disable one-on-one chats with AI characters and block specific AI personas their children might encounter. The company stated these features will begin rolling out early next year as part of a broader initiative to address child safety concerns.
